Alfred Posted May 8, 2019 Share Posted May 8, 2019 I don’t have experience of any iPad other than my humble Air 2. However, from what I’ve read about the iPad Air 3 and the 10.5” iPad Pro, the Pro model has a significantly slower CPU than the newer Air 3 but it has a much faster GPU, 4GB of RAM instead of 3GB, four speakers instead of two, and a better camera.
